The No. 9 BYU Cougars (5-1) are set to face the Dayton Flyers (6-1) in the championship game of the 2025 ESPN Events Invitational at the State Farm Field House in Kissimmee, Florida. This matchup presents a significant opportunity for both...
BYU enters the game with a strong 5-1 record, showcasing a high-powered offense and solid defense. Their performance against Miami in the Invitational demonstrated their ability to pull away in the second half with strong defensive plays. Dayton, with a 6-1 record, has proven their resilience with dramatic overtime wins against Marquette and Georgetown. Their only loss came against Big 12 opponent Cincinnati.
The game presents an intriguing clash of styles, with BYU's potent offense testing Dayton's stout defense. Key players for BYU, such as AJ Dybantsa and Richie Saunders, will need to perform at their best to counter Dayton's defensive pressure. Javon Bennett and De’Shayne Montgomery will be crucial for Dayton, aiming to control the game's tempo and exploit BYU's defensive gaps.
According to ESPN Analytics, at halftime, BYU trailed Dayton with a score of 30-36. BYU's field goal percentage was 33% compared to Dayton's 45%.

BYU averages 84.7 points scored and 67.5 points allowed per game, while Dayton averages 79.0 points scored and 68.6 points allowed per game.
Key players for BYU include AJ Dybantsa, Richie Saunders, and Kennard Davis Jr. For Dayton, watch Javon Bennett, De’Shayne Montgomery, and Amaël L’Etang.
